## Step 4: Move the TideGlass widget

New hires: TideGlass renders tide tables for the Port Merrow demo site. Migration is mechanical. Delete the old `tideglass-legacy` chart, then deploy via Harborline like every other widget. Do not copy the old values file — half of it references the retired Saltwick cluster and will break DNS resolution. Run the smoke check before and after. The settings below replace everything in the legacy chart; use them verbatim for staging.

deployment values, kajep-kageg:
[praix]
host = praix.paliqcorp.corp
user = praix_svc
database = praix_prod

## Webhook Delivery: Retry Semantics

Marrowdale retries failed webhook deliveries with exponential backoff (base 2s, cap 15m, max 8 attempts). Attempts are idempotent: each delivery carries a stable event identifier, and receivers must deduplicate on it. Responses other than 2xx count as failures; 410 permanently disables the endpoint. Every outbound request is signed, and the signing credential is set by the following line:

secret setting of yafof-tawep: RELAY_SECRET8=8abb5772

// RETRY_BACKOFF_MS governs how long the Lumenpay integration suite waits
// between settlement-webhook retries. The flakiness we saw in the Corventis
// sandbox traced back to a race between ledger commit and webhook dispatch,
// not to timeout tuning, so please resist lowering this further. If a run
// still flakes, capture the token the harness prints after teardown.

trace token, fafog-kageg: htk4_98e6

Subject: DR Drill — Public API Pagination

Team,

Thursday's drill simulates loss of the Northquay region serving the Latchfield public REST API. Focus area: cursor pagination. Verify cursors issued pre-failover remain valid post-failover, or that clients receive a clean 410 with a restart hint. Capture latency on page fetches above offset 10k. Findings go to the security review packet by Friday. Failover requires unsealing the standby config vault; the vault prompt accepts the passphrase that follows.

vault phrase of taguf-taguf = ralath-briwyn